Tony Burton is an author, editor and publisher, with several years of experience both in the non-fiction and fiction arenas. He wrote training manuals and technical guides for organizations such as America Online, Citibank and the U.S. government. He has published over 140 stories, articles and columns in a variety of venues, including newspapers, Crime and Suspense, ThugLit and Reflection’s Edge ezines, as well as Focus On Your Child, and Great Mystery and Suspense magazine. He has also contributed stories to three anthologies, edited two anthologies and written two cozy mystery novels. (A third in that series is in progress.)
Tony and his lovely wife, Lara, live in NW Georgia with their champion napdog, Buddy, and recently added members of the family: Atticus, Arabella, Jem and Scout--four zebra finches.
